Как конвертировать TIFF в JPG Внутри Silverlight, на стороне клиента, используя элемент управления или класс / функцию? - PullRequest
3 голосов
/ 17 декабря 2009

Мы создаем клиент в Silverlight, который будет показывать много изображений в формате TIFF. Silverlight изначально не поддерживает TIFF. Мне нужен элемент управления / класс для преобразования TIFF в JPG во время выполнения внутри клиента Silverlight. Есть идеи?

Ответы [ 3 ]

1 голос
/ 22 апреля 2010

Мне удалось отобразить TIFF в Silverlight. Легко портировать бесплатную библиотеку LibTiff.NET на Silverlight, требуется всего 3-4 незначительных настройки.

Сама библиотека довольно унаследована и необработанна для использования, и все еще нужно иметь некоторые знания о внутренней работе формата TIFF, чтобы иметь возможность извлекать данные изображений так, как они нужны.

Но это выполнимо, и куски и куски можно затем разделить на WriteableBitmap.

1 голос
/ 04 августа 2010

Не уверен, что вас интересует решение, но мы только что выпустили LibTiff.Net 2.0 с поддержкой Silverlight, улучшенной документацией и примерами.

В пакете с исходным кодом есть тестовое приложение Silverlight, в котором показано, как создать WriteableBitmap из изображений TIFF в Silverlight. Может быть, это поможет вам или другим.

1 голос
/ 20 декабря 2009

В прошлую пятницу на форуме Silverlight я получил это сообщение:


Re: Как конвертировать TIFF в JPG Внутри Silverlight, на стороне клиента, используя элемент управления или класс / функцию? 12-18-2009 17:38 |

Если вы хотите использовать стороннюю библиотеку, обратитесь к ImageGear for Silverlight, предоставленному Accusoft Pegasus. Это 100% управляемый набор инструментов Silverlight (http://www.accusoft.com/ig-silverlight.htm),, который полностью работает на клиенте. Включена поддержка TIFF (среди множества других форматов).
Надеюсь это поможет, Кейси


...